The Importance of Setting Boundaries in Your Business

The importance of setting boundaries in your business is essential to maintaining a healthy work environment and crucial for the success and well-being of any business.

One of the key components of creating such an environment is setting boundaries. Boundaries serve as guidelines that define acceptable behavior, expectations, and limits in the workplace.

In this article, we’ll delve into the significance of setting boundaries in your business and explore the positive impact they can have on productivity, work-life balance, and professional relationships.

Clear boundaries. Sign on a beach that says public property ends here

Without clearly defined boundaries, businesses often encounter challenges that can disrupt workflow and impact employee morale. Blurred lines between work and personal life can lead to burnout, stress, and decreased job satisfaction. 

Additionally, difficulties in managing client expectations can result in scope creep, missed deadlines, and strained relationships. When boundaries are not established, it becomes challenging to maintain a healthy work environment where everyone feels respected, valued, and supported.

Setting boundaries in your business requires proactive communication and a commitment to upholding standards of professionalism.

Here are some practical solutions for establishing and maintaining boundaries:

1. Communication: Clearly communicate your expectations and boundaries to clients, colleagues, and employees from the outset. Be upfront about your availability, response times, and the scope of work. Encourage open dialogue and address any concerns or misunderstandings promptly.

2. Time Management: Implement effective time management strategies to prioritize tasks and allocate sufficient time for work and personal activities. Set realistic deadlines and avoid overcommitting to projects or tasks that may compromise your ability to deliver quality results.

3. Define Roles and Responsibilities: Clearly define roles and responsibilities within your team to avoid confusion and overlap. Establish clear lines of authority and delegate tasks accordingly. Encourage collaboration and teamwork while respecting individual boundaries and autonomy.

4. Practice Assertiveness: Learn to assertively assert your boundaries and say no when necessary. Be firm but respectful in setting limits and addressing behavior that violates your boundaries. Remember that setting boundaries is essential for maintaining self-respect and protecting your well-being.

Having and holding clear boundaries in your business yields numerous benefits for both individuals and organizations:

Improved Work-Life Balance: Setting boundaries allows you to prioritize your time and energy, leading to a better balance between work and personal life. This helps prevent burnout and enhances overall well-being. See my blog on Navigating Work Life Balance as an Entrepreneur.

Increased Productivity: Clear boundaries help streamline workflow and eliminate distractions, resulting in increased focus and productivity. By establishing limits on interruptions and non-essential tasks, you can maximize efficiency and achieve better results in less time.

Enhanced Professional Relationships: Setting boundaries fosters respect and mutual understanding among colleagues, clients, and employees. By clearly defining expectations and respecting each other’s boundaries, you can build trust, collaboration, and stronger professional relationships.

Setting boundaries is essential for creating a healthy, productive work environment where individuals feel valued, respected, and supported.

By addressing the challenges that arise from the lack of boundaries and implementing practical solutions for establishing and maintaining boundaries, businesses can enjoy improved work-life balance, increased productivity, and enhanced professional relationships.

Remember that boundaries are not limitations but rather tools for fostering growth, success, and well-being in your business.

Navigating Work-Life Balance as an Entrepreneur

Navigating work-life balance as an entreprenuer is no easy feat. As entrepreneurs, we often find ourselves juggling multiple responsibilities, wearing numerous hats, and working long hours to keep our ventures afloat. However, amidst the hustle and bustle of entrepreneurship, it’s essential not to overlook the importance of maintaining a healthy work-life balance.

In this article, we’ll explore the challenges of achieving work-life balance as an entrepreneur, the negative impacts of imbalance, and practical strategies for finding harmony between work and personal life.

Burned out, stressed man with his head down, holding a card that says Help

Navigating work-life balance as an entrepreneur.

The relentless pursuit of business success can take a toll on our well-being, leading to stress, burnout, and strained relationships. Entrepreneurs often find themselves working around the clock, sacrificing sleep, leisure time, and personal relationships in the name of success.

However, this imbalance can have detrimental effects on both our physical and mental health, leaving us feeling exhausted, overwhelmed, and disconnected from the things that truly matter in life.

Achieving work-life balance requires conscious effort and intentional planning.

Here are some practical strategies for navigating work-life balance as an entrepreneur:

1. Set Boundaries:

Establish clear boundaries between work and personal life, such as designated work hours and technology-free zones at home. Communicate these boundaries to clients, employees, and family members to ensure respect and adherence.

2. Prioritize Self-Care:

Make self-care a priority by incorporating activities that promote physical, mental, and emotional well-being into your daily routine. This could include exercise, meditation, hobbies, or spending quality time with loved ones.

3. Schedule Downtime: Block out time in your schedule for relaxation and leisure activities. Whether it’s a weekend getaway, a movie night with family, or a quiet evening alone, prioritize downtime to recharge and rejuvenate. Bonus tip: schedule breaks during your work time to go bare foot outside on the earth and get a little sun on your face- it is extremely grounding and rejuvenating! Or at the very least to move your body as we sit a lot of the day.

4. Delegate and Outsource:

Learn to delegate tasks and outsource responsibilities that don’t require your direct involvement. Trusting others to handle certain aspects of your business allows you to focus on high-priority tasks and enjoy more free time.

5. Practice Time Management:

Efficient time management is key to balancing competing priorities. Use tools and techniques such as to-do lists, prioritization, and time blocking to maximize productivity and minimize time spent on non-essential tasks.

Finding harmony between work and personal life yields numerous benefits for entrepreneurs and those benefits defintely outweigh the cost!

Improved Health: Achieving work-life balance reduces stress levels, lowers the risk of burnout, and promotes overall physical and mental well-being.

Increased Productivity: Balanced entrepreneurs are more focused, motivated, and productive, leading to better business outcomes and greater success.

Benefit and cost

Enhanced Relationships: Prioritizing personal relationships strengthens bonds with family and friends, fostering a sense of connection and support outside of work.

Greater Fulfillment: Balancing work and personal life allows entrepreneurs to lead more fulfilling, meaningful lives, pursuing their passions and enjoying a sense of fulfillment beyond business success.

As entrepreneurs, achieving work-life balance is essential for long-term success and well-being.

By recognizing the negative impacts of imbalance, implementing practical strategies for balance, and embracing the benefits of harmony, entrepreneurs can enjoy greater health, productivity, and fulfillment in both their professional and personal lives.

Remember, finding balance is not a one-time achievement but an ongoing journey that requires attention, intention, and commitment.

The Impact of Effective Delegation on Business Success

The impact of effective delegation on business success is an important learning experience for most entreprenuers.

Delegation is a cornerstone of effective leadership and business management.

Yet, many entrepreneurs and business owners struggle to delegate effectively, fearing loss of control or lack of trust in their team members.

However, delegation is essential for achieving scalability, fostering employee growth, and driving business success. In this article, we’ll explore the importance of effective delegation in business and how it can unlock growth opportunities and elevate organizational performance

Delegation is more than just assigning tasks; it’s about empowering others to take ownership, make decisions, and contribute to the overall success of the business.

Effective delegation allows leaders to focus on high-value activities, such as strategic planning, relationship-building, creation and innovation, revenue and client growth, while empowering team members to handle day-to-day responsibilities with confidence and autonomy.

By distributing workload strategically and leveraging the skills and strengths of team members, businesses can optimize productivity, foster innovation, and achieve better outcomes.

 

Focus on high-value activities

Successful delegation is rooted in clear communication, trust, and accountability.

Here are some key principles to keep in mind when delegating tasks and responsibilities:

1. Clearly Define Expectations:

Clearly communicate the objectives, timelines, and desired outcomes of delegated tasks to ensure alignment and clarity. Having the correct tech tools in place for this makes it super easy for everyone to be on the same page: Slack for communication, Asana for project management and Google Drive for all your documents and SOPs.

2. Match Tasks to Skills:

Assign tasks to team members based on their skills, strengths, and interests to maximize efficiency and effectiveness.

One key piece of advice I remember from a mentor of mine back in the corporate world was “Just because someone isn’t succeeding in their current positon doesn’t mean they need to go. It might mean they aren’t in the right position and we aren’t using their skillset and strenghts correctly.”

3. Provide Necessary Resources:

Equip team members with the tools, resources, and support they need to succeed in their delegated roles.

SOPs again are a huge asset here to ensure they are not only trained for their job responsibilities but they are doing it the way you want it done.

4. Encourage Autonomy:

Empower team members to make decisions and take ownership of their delegated tasks, fostering a sense of autonomy and accountability.

One of the main learning experiences for me as a leader was to step back once team members are trained and allow them to make mistakes and successes. Without knowing where we missed training steps or more training is needed, they most certainly will fail at some tasks. On top of that, allowing them to come up with solutions empowers them to become a leader in their department, which leads to increased job satisfaction.

5. Offer Feedback and Support:

Provide regular feedback, guidance, and support to team members as they work on delegated tasks, helping them grow and develop professionally.

Quarterly evaluations, weekly training calls for the first 90 days and weekly team meetings not only foster a sense of team and comraderies, it allows you to check in consistently on tasks and how things are going for them.

On top of the principles of delegating, there are benefits for you as a business owner to truly embrace delegation and how it will change your life and how you do business!

1) Delegating tasks provides valuable learning opportunities for team members, helping them develop new skills and grow professionally.

    2) Empowering team members to take ownership of tasks encourages creativity and innovation, driving continuous improvement and business growth.

    3) Delegating tasks allows leaders to achieve a better work-life balance by reducing workload and stress levels.

    4) Delegating tasks strategically enables businesses to scale operations and pursue growth opportunities more effectively.

      The impact of effective delegation on business success and its benefits

      Effective delegation is a fundamental skill for business leaders and managers. By mastering the art of delegation, businesses can unlock growth opportunities, foster employee development, and achieve better outcomes.

      From clearly defining expectations and providing necessary resources to offering feedback and support, there are numerous strategies for delegating tasks effectively. By accepting and using delegation as a strategic tool for empowerment and growth, businesses can position themselves for long-term success in today’s competitive marketplace.

      Reclaiming Your Time and Passion

      Take the first step in reclaiming your time and passion as an entrepreneur.

      As an entrepreneur and business owner,  you can find yourself caught in a never-ending cycle of busyness, constantly juggling multiple tasks and wearing multiple hats. 

      While dedication and hard work are important, it’s easy to lose sight of why you started your businesses in the first place: to pursue your passions and create a life of purpose and fulfillment. In this blog post, we’ll explore strategies for reclaiming your time and passion and prioritizing what matters most in your business and life.

      First and foremost, let’s reevaluate your priorities. Take a step back and reflect on what truly matters to you, both personally and professionally. 

      I’d love for you to take the time to journal about these questions and really reflect on your answers.

      What are your core values? 

      What brings you joy and fulfillment? 

      What activities or tasks drain your energy and passion the most in your daily life and business?

      Are there any hobbies or interests that you’ve neglected due to your busy schedule? How do you feel when you make time for them?

      Have you noticed any areas of your business where you’ve lost enthusiasm or motivation? What steps could you take to reignite your passion in those areas?

       

      Reclaiming Your Time and Passion Journling

      How do you prioritize self-care and personal time amidst the demands of running a business?

      What are some strategies you’ve found effective in setting boundaries and reclaiming your time from work-related tasks?

      Are there any goals or dreams you’ve put on hold because of your hectic schedule? How could you start working towards them again?

      Reflecting on your past achievements, which ones brought you the most fulfillment and joy? How can you incorporate more of those activities into your life and business?

      By clarifying your priorities, you can focus your time and energy on activities that align with your values and bring you closer to your goals.

      No

      Additionally, learn to say no.

      As entrepreneurs, we often feel pressure to say yes to every opportunity that comes our way, fearing that we’ll miss out on something important.

      However, saying yes to too many things can lead to overwhelm and burnout.

      Instead, be selective about where you invest your time and energy, prioritizing activities that align with your goals and values.

      Furthermore, delegate tasks that don’t align with your strengths or passions. 

      As much as I love connecting on social media and watching my connections grow, it isn’t something that I really love to do every single day. Posting content can drain me. So I farm it out. What I love is creating my content, that really lights me up.

      As business owners, we often feel like we have to do everything ourselves, but this can lead to exhaustion and resentment.

      Instead, empower your team members to take on responsibility and contribute their expertise to key tasks and projects.

      Delegating effectively allows you to focus on activities that bring you joy and fulfillment, while also empowering your team to grow and excel.

      Exhuasted business owner

      Reclaiming your time and passion is essential for creating a life of purpose and fulfillment as an entrepreneur. By clarifying your priorities, learning to say no, and delegating effectively, you can focus your time and energy on activities that bring you joy and move you closer to your goals. Remember, your business should be a source of inspiration and fulfillment, not a source of stress and exhaustion.

      Streamlining Your Business for Success

      Streamlining your business for success doesn’t take as much time or energy as you think! A few simple changes can make a world of difference.

      Efficiency is another important piece of staying competitive and driving growth. Automation is also one I talked about on my last blog here.

      As an entrepreneur and business owner, streamlining your business operations is essential for maximizing productivity, minimizing waste, and achieving your goals. In this blog post, we’ll explore strategies for streamlining your business and unlocking its full potential for success.

      Streamlining Your Business for Success

      First let’s identify probable  areas of inefficiency within your business. This could include manual processes, redundant tasks, or outdated systems that are slowing you down.

      By conducting a thorough audit of your operations, you can pinpoint areas for improvement and develop a roadmap for streamlining your workflow.

      One of the most effective strategies for streamlining your business is to leverage technology.

      Investing in the right tech tools and systems can automate repetitive tasks, centralize data, and improve collaboration among team members. Whether it’s project management software, accounting tools, or customer relationship management (CRM) systems, technology can help you work smarter, not harder. You can learn more on my Tech blog here.

      Additionally, simplifying your processes can lead to greater efficiency. Look for opportunities to eliminate unnecessary steps, standardize workflows, and remove bottlenecks that are hindering productivity.

      By streamlining your processes, you can reduce the risk of errors, improve consistency, and free up valuable time for more strategic activities.

      Keep it simple!

      One other simple change is delegation. A quick and surprisingly easy way to streamline your business operations. As an entrepreneur, it’s tempting to try to do everything yourself, but this can lead to burnout and inefficiency. Instead, empower your team members to take on responsibility and contribute their expertise to key tasks and projects. Delegating effectively allows you to focus on high-value activities that drive growth and innovation.

      Streamlining is just another piece for your business to stay competitive and achieve long-term success. By leveraging technology, simplifying processes, and delegating effectively, you can optimize your operations and unlock new opportunities for growth. Whether you’re a startup or an established enterprise, investing in streamlining your business is essential for staying agile and adaptable.
